The is widely regarded as the "Holy Grail" of brass pedagogy. Originally written for the cornet in the mid-19th century, this method has been adapted for nearly every brass instrument, with the tuba version serving as a foundational pillar for university-level and professional study. Most tuba teachers pair Arban with Rochut (Bordogni transcriptions). These are public domain and available legally as PDFs. They handle the singing quality that Arban handles the technical quality.
